Insulation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on ceiling Yes No You can safely clean and repair the stain yourself.
Visible mold growth in insulation No Yes Mold can spread quickly and pose serious health risks; call a professional to ensure safe removal.
Water damage to entire insulation system No Yes Replacing or repairing an entire insulation system needs specialized equipment and expertise.
Unusual noises or sounds in insulation Maybe Yes While you can try to diagnose the issue, a professional will ensure a thorough inspection and safe resolution.
Increased energy bills with no visible signs of damage Maybe Yes A professional can help identify the root cause of the issue and provide recommendations for repair or replacement.
Cracked or broken insulation with no visible signs of damage No Yes A professional will ensure a thorough inspection and safe repair or replacement of the insulation.

While some minor issues can be handled DIY, it’s essential to call a professional for more complex or widespread problems. Our team has the expertise and equipment to ensure safe and effective Insulation Water Damage Restoration.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ost in Delaware, OK

The cost of Insulation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Delaware, OK. These est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ners have encountered: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Insulation Replacement $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of insulation, and labor costs.
Water Removal and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water, equipment rental costs, and labor costs.
Sanitizing and Deodorizing $200 – $1,000 Type of products used, labor costs, and size of affected area.
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ue, and labor costs.
Repair or Replacement of Insulation System $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of insulation, and labor costs.
More Repairs or Renovations $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of work, materials needed, and labor costs.
